MBABANE – Manzini Wanderers, the MTN Premier League giants, face a major blow, as they prepare for their league opener this weekend.

Captain Mlamuli ‘Mlaba’ Nkambule will be out for an estimated three weeks due to an injury. The news comes as a major hurdle for the maroon and white hub giants, who are finally set to make their official league appearance after spending the entire 2024/25 season away from competitive football.

Wanderers Public Relations Officer (PRO) Mongi Simelane confirmed that the squad is otherwise ready and morale is high ahead of their derby clash against city rivals Moneni Pirates this Saturday at the Mavuso Sports Centre.

“The only challenge we face is that of our Skipper ‘Mlaba,’ who is still nursing the injury he sustained during the 8Bet Trade Fair Cup match against Green Mamba,” Simelane said.

“I think he will be back after three weeks, but the team is ready and the spirit is high at training.”

It is worth noting that the ‘Weslians’ did not participate in the previous season, which was won by Nsingizini Hotspurs, as they were fighting to retain their MTN Premier League status in court.
